The USIU-Africa Library stands as a central hub for academic excellence, digital innovation, and knowledge-sharing. As the university continues to champion sustainability through its infrastructure and operations, the library is exploring renewable energy solutions to power its services more reliably and affordably.
To support this, the alumni are leading the Greening the Library Initiative aimed at installing solar power in the library. This initiative will improve the library’s energy efficiency, cut down on the electrical bills, and support environmental sustainability by increasing reliance on clean energy. The initiative has the potential to save an estimated KES 18 million annually in electricity bills, money that can be used for other development activities in the university.
Sustainable change can begin with small, intentional actions that encourage others to follow suit. This initiative supports USIU-Africa’s dedication to sustainability and the United Nations Sustainable Development Goals, especially Affordable and Clean Energy (SDG 7) and Climate Action (SDG 13).
In addition to transitioning the library from electricity to solar energy, the initiative aims to communicate that collective responsibility and community involvement are crucial in addressing climate change.
